EEC-MAC:一种无线传感器网络的节能分簇MAC算法
需积分: 13 14 浏览量
更新于2024-08-11
收藏 274KB PDF 举报
"基于分簇的无线传感器网络MAC节能算法 (2012年) - 掌明, 王经卓, 董自健"
本文主要探讨了一种名为EEC-MAC(Energy-Efficient Clustering MAC)的无线传感器网络介质访问控制节能算法,该算法旨在减少节点能耗并提升信道利用率。无线传感器网络通常由大量低功耗设备组成,它们需要高效地通信以收集和传输环境信息。在这种背景下,EEC-MAC算法利用了分簇结构来优化网络性能。
EEC-MAC算法构建在时分多址(TDMA)的基础之上,这是一种时间分割的方法,允许每个节点在预定的时间段内独占信道进行通信。为了进一步节省能源,算法引入了时隙系数,可以根据簇内节点的数据传输需求动态调整时隙大小,从而减少不必要的等待时间和传输时延。对于那些没有数据需要发送的节点,EEC-MAC不为其分配时隙,使它们能进入更深的休眠状态,延长电池寿命。
此外,EEC-MAC还考虑了节点的剩余能量因素。簇内的节点根据其剩余能量系数来决定时隙分配顺序,这样能量充足的节点可以先进行通信,避免了频繁的状态转换,减少了额外的能量消耗。而在簇与簇之间的通信中,EEC-MAC采用了载波监听多址冲突避免(CSMA/CA)机制的随机分配策略,以处理多簇间的通信竞争,这有助于分散信道压力,减少冲突。
通过仿真研究,EEC-MAC算法表现出显著的节能效果,其平均通信时延较低,同时网络生命周期得以延长。这表明,EEC-MAC不仅提高了能源效率,还优化了网络的整体性能。该研究得到了国家自然科学基金等多个项目的资助,作者包括掌明、王经卓和董自健,他们在无线传感器网络和网络安全领域有深入的研究。
关键词: 无线传感器网络, 介质访问控制, 分簇, 节能算法, 时隙分配
这篇论文对无线传感器网络中的能源管理问题提供了新的解决方案,特别是在大规模部署和长期运行的场景下,如环境监测、工业自动化和物联网应用等,这种节能策略显得尤为重要。EEC-MAC算法的提出,有助于设计出更持久、更高效的无线传感器网络系统。
2009-12-05 上传
2021-09-29 上传
点击了解资源详情
点击了解资源详情
2011-05-29 上传
2020-10-26 上传
2021-06-15 上传
2021-10-15 上传
weixin_38589774
- 粉丝: 4
- 资源: 952
最新资源
- 探索数据转换实验平台在设备装置中的应用
- 使用git-log-to-tikz.py将Git日志转换为TIKZ图形
- 小栗子源码2.9.3版本发布
- 使用Tinder-Hack-Client实现Tinder API交互
- Android Studio新模板:个性化Material Design导航抽屉
- React API分页模块:数据获取与页面管理
- C语言实现顺序表的动态分配方法
- 光催化分解水产氢固溶体催化剂制备技术揭秘
- VS2013环境下tinyxml库的32位与64位编译指南
- 网易云歌词情感分析系统实现与架构
- React应用展示GitHub用户详细信息及项目分析
- LayUI2.1.6帮助文档API功能详解
- 全栈开发实现的chatgpt应用可打包小程序/H5/App
- C++实现顺序表的动态内存分配技术
- Java制作水果格斗游戏:策略与随机性的结合
- 基于若依框架的后台管理系统开发实例解析